Solution Overview
Problem
Conventional physical badges are static and unable to adapt to changing identities or roles in real-time, failing to provide dynamic and secure access to resources and information.
Innovation Solution
A system that allows users to select from a plurality of badges and identities, using blockchain technology to update and validate the selected badge, enabling dynamic identity presentation and secure access through QR codes or links, with permissions-based access control.

Data Source
AI summary
Aspects of the subject disclosure may include, for example, authenticating a credential of a first user of a first device, based on the authenticating, providing the first user with an option to select a badge from a plurality of badges via the first device, based on the providing of the option, obtaining a selection of a first badge included in the plurality of badges from the first device, resulting in a selected badge, and based on the obtaining of the selection, transferring an identification of the selected badge to the first device. Other embodiments are disclosed.
